We are sharing a specialised part-time consulting opportunity for experienced legal research professionals with substantial hands-on expertise using Lexis+ for case law, statutory, regulatory, and multi-jurisdictional research. This role focuses on evaluating sophisticated legal research for authority, currency, completeness, and professional accuracy. Selected professionals will verify cases, statutes, regulations, quotations, holdings, and citations; identify missing controlling authority; distinguish binding from persuasive precedent; and apply advanced Lexis+ research techniques to complex legal questions. Key Responsibilities Case Law & Citation Validation Verify cases, statutes, and regulations cited in legal research Confirm that authorities remain good law for the specific proposition cited Identify negative Shepard's treatment, overruling risk, superseded authority, and other validity concerns Verify quotations, holdings, pin cites, and descriptions of judicial decisions Identify nonexistent, mischaracterised, or incorrectly cited authorities Lexis+ Research & Shepard's Review Use Shepard's Citations Service to evaluate subsequent treatment and authority status Interpret Shepard's Signal indicators and Depth of Discussion information Review citing references and assess the significance of positive, negative, or questioning treatment Distinguish overruled, superseded, depublished, and factually distinguished authorities Apply verify-before-finalise research practices consistently Advanced Legal Research Conduct terms-and-connectors, natural-language, and segment-based searches Use Lexis Headnotes, Case Summaries, Case Notes, and annotated statutory materials Work with Lexis+ and Protégé features for litigation research and AI-assisted discovery Use secondary authorities including treatises, ALR, Am. Jur., practice guides, and Practical Guidance Evaluate 50-state and multi-jurisdictional research while keeping jurisdictional differences clearly separated Statutory, Regulatory & Currency Review Review annotated statutes and regulations for currentness and applicability Identify historical versions and changes in statutory or regulatory language Determine which version of a law was in force on a specific operative date Assess effective dates, amendments, superseding provisions, and related authority Verify that legal conclusions rely on the correct law for the relevant period Research Completeness & Quality Evaluation Determine whether controlling authority has been identified Identify significant on-point cases or authorities omitted from an analysis Distinguish binding precedent from persuasive authority Review legal research for completeness, methodological rigour, and defensibility Provide clear written feedback explaining research deficiencies and required corrections Ideal Profile Strong candidates may have: At least 2 years of professional legal research experience Frequent substantive use of Lexis+, typically weekly or more, in a current or recent professional role Strong practical knowledge of Shepard's and legal citation validation Ability to quickly identify weak citations, misstated holdings, outdated statutes, and authority problems Experience conducting complex case law, statutory, regulatory, or multi-jurisdictional research Strong understanding of hierarchy of authority and jurisdictional precedent Excellent legal writing, analytical reasoning, and attention to detail Educational Background A Juris Doctor degree with bar admission is highly relevant An MLIS or equivalent qualification combined with professional law librarian or legal research experience may also qualify Equivalent research-intensive professional experience may be considered Advanced training in legal research, litigation, statutory analysis, or legal information systems may strengthen an application Nice to Have Advanced familiarity with Lexis+ with Protégé Experience using Shepard's Graphical and litigation issue filters Familiarity with Lex Machina Litigation Analytics Experience with CourtLink, PACER, Brief Analysis, or comparable litigation research tools Background conducting 50-state surveys or complex multi-jurisdictional research Experience using Matthew Bender treatises, ALR, Am.
